1. Stop a wage that is administrative for figuratively speaking as you had been fired

Into the this past year before the garnishment began, had been you fired or laid off from the work?

That which you need to do is this:

Demand a hearing utilising the hearing demand kind. Check out the package that states you’ve been involuntarily ended from your own final task and also been used in your overall work for under one year.

You’ve got the burden to show which you had been involuntarily terminated and that you’ve been at your brand-new work at under 12 months. Therefore be sure you connect proof. A typical example of evidence will be a page from your own previous manager showing you were involuntarily ended and page from your own new boss showing your begin date.

Financial hardship meaning for student education loans

Financial hardship means you can’t meet with the living that is basic for products and services needed for the survival of both you and your dependents. The hearing officer will compare your costs up against the quantities the IRS claims should always be invested for fundamental cost of living by categories of the exact same size and comparable earnings to yours. In the event that costs you claim are greater than the IRS amounts, you have to show the total amount you claim is necessary and reasonable.

Samples of significant improvement in financial predicament

The samples of what’s considered a considerably changed financial predicament are pretty limited. Fundamentally, your financial predicament has significantly changed if you suffered an after you got notice of the garnishment:

  • Damage
  • Breakup or
  • Catastrophic disease

3. Rehabilitate your loans to quit education loan garnishment

In the event that you contacted the personal collection agency whoever garnishing you, they most likely attempted to allow you to rehabilitate your loans.

Rehabilitation does a few things:

It stops the garnishment and gets you away from standard.

But rehabilitation takes some time. You rehabilitate your defaulted loans by making 9 monthly obligations within 10 months. What this means is it is possible to miss one re re re payment and qualify for rehabilitation still. Here’s the catch though, while you’re making those monthly premiums, the garnishment continues. You’ll keep getting garnished for at the least 5 more months.

Once you create your fifth repayment, your garnishment should really be suspended. It shall be reactivated, nonetheless, in the event that you don’t finish the rehabilitation program.

NOTE: never register your taxes if you’re rehabilitating your loans. The Department of Education can take your refund still in case your loan continues to be in standard. Wait before you finalize the rehab system as well as your loan may be out of standard before you file your fees. Request an extension if need be.

5. File a chapter 7 or 13 bankruptcy to prevent an administrative wage garnishment

My experience is the fact that in the event that additional options fail, filing bankruptcy to quit an administrative wage garnishment makes lots of feeling.

Once you file bankruptcy, your garnishment must stop. The thing is, filing bankruptcy causes what’s called the stay that is automatic. The stay that is automatic essentially a shield that temporarily protects you against creditors. While that shield is with in spot, you need to have time and energy to get your breathing to get your monetary life in an effort.

At the very least that is the hope.

Another advantage is the fact that in the end of your bankruptcy case — about a couple of months for the chapter 7 and about three to five years for the chapter 13 — much of your debts should be released. Needless to say, you’ll still need certainly to pay off your student education loans. You theoretically needs to have additional money left up to spend to your figuratively speaking since you will have gotten rid of one’s other financial obligation.
